MIRAPH ENT., INC. v. BD. OF ALCO. BEV., PATERSON


150 N.J. Super. 504 (1977)

376 A.2d 189

MIRAPH ENTERPRISES, INC., T/A THE CABARET, 11 HAMILTON STREET, PATERSON, NEW JERSEY, APPELLANT, v. BOARD OF ALCOHOLIC BEVERAGE CONTROL FOR THE CITY OF PATERSON, RESPONDENT.

Superior Court of New Jersey, Appellate Division.

Decided June 13, 1977.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Messrs. Tanis & Sternick, attorneys for appellant (Mr. Michael A. Sternick on the brief).

Mr. Joseph A. LaCava, Corporation Counsel, attorney for respondent (Mr. Ralph L. DeLuccia, Jr., Assistant Corporation Counsel, of counsel and on the brief).

Before Judges BISCHOFF, MORGAN and KING.


PER CURIAM.

In this appeal from a determination by the Division of Alcoholic Beverage Control and disciplinary action taken in connection therewith, we find ourselves constrained to comment initially on the deplorable inadequacy of appellant's brief, just one example of a problem which has been recurring with ever increasing frequency.
